Note When connecting a display to the Thunderbolt 3 USB-C port,
a USB-C video adapter might be required depending on the
input of your display.
Secondary Thunderbolt 3 port can also be used to connect
USB 3.1 (10Gbps) USB-Type C devices, such as USB 3.1
Storage Enclosure or Hubs. Backwards compatible with USB
3.1 Gen 1 (USB 3.0), and USB 2.0.
USB 3.1 Gen 1 is also known as USB 3.0; this connectivity
standard offers speeds up to 5Gbps. USB 3.1 Gen 2 offers
speeds up to 10Gbps.
